linux配置php、linux配置php运行环境
要配置PHP运行环境,需要先安装Linux操作系统。Linux是一种开源的操作系统,具有稳定性和安全性高的特点。可以选择常见的Linux发行版,如Ubuntu、CentOS等。安装Linux操作系统的具体步骤可以参考相关的官方文档或教程。
2. 安装Apache服务器
安装完Linux操作系统后,需要安装Apache服务器来运行PHP。Apache是一种常用的Web服务器软件,可以支持PHP的解析和运行。可以使用包管理工具来安装Apache,如在Ubuntu上可以使用apt-get命令,CentOS上可以使用yum命令。
3. 安装PHP
安装完Apache服务器后,需要安装PHP。PHP是一种服务器端脚本语言,用于处理动态网页内容。可以使用包管理工具来安装PHP,如在Ubuntu上可以使用apt-get命令,CentOS上可以使用yum命令。安装完PHP后,还需要安装一些常用的PHP扩展,如MySQL扩展、GD库等。
4. 配置Apache服务器
安装完Apache和PHP后,需要对Apache进行一些配置。需要修改Apache的配置文件httpd.conf,可以通过编辑该文件来修改一些基本的配置,如监听端口、虚拟主机等。还需要配置Apache的模块,如启用PHP模块,可以通过编辑mods-available目录下的php.conf文件来进行配置。
5. 配置PHP
安装完PHP后,还需要对PHP进行一些配置。可以通过编辑php.ini文件来修改PHP的配置。可以设置一些基本的配置项,如时区、内存限制等。还可以设置PHP的错误报告级别,以便在开发过程中能够及时发现和解决问题。
6. 配置数据库
在配置PHP运行环境时,通常需要使用到数据库。可以选择常用的数据库软件,如MySQL、PostgreSQL等。需要先安装数据库软件,然后创建数据库和用户,并设置相应的权限。在PHP中可以使用数据库扩展来连接和操作数据库,如mysqli、PDO等。
7. 配置虚拟主机
为了能够支持多个网站或应用程序,可以配置虚拟主机。虚拟主机可以让一台服务器上运行多个网站,每个网站有独立的域名和目录。可以通过编辑Apache的配置文件来配置虚拟主机,设置每个虚拟主机的域名、目录、日志等。
8. 配置安全性
在配置PHP运行环境时,要注意安全性的设置。可以通过配置Apache的访问控制来限制对服务器的访问。可以设置防火墙规则,只允许特定的IP地址或IP段访问服务器。还可以配置PHP的安全相关选项,如禁用危险函数、限制文件上传等。
9. 配置日志
为了方便排查和分析问题,可以配置日志记录。可以通过编辑Apache的配置文件来设置日志的格式和路径。可以设置不同的日志级别,以便记录不同级别的信息。可以定期清理过期的日志文件,以节省磁盘空间。
10. 配置性能优化
为了提高PHP运行环境的性能,可以进行一些优化配置。可以调整Apache的并发连接数和线程数,以适应不同的访问量。可以启用缓存机制,如使用APC、Memcached等。还可以对PHP代码进行优化,如减少数据库查询、使用缓存等。
通过以上步骤,我们可以成功配置PHP运行环境。安装Linux操作系统、Apache服务器和PHP,并进行相应的配置,可以使得PHP能够正常运行。还可以根据实际需求进行一些额外的配置,如数据库、虚拟主机、安全性等。配置好的PHP运行环境可以满足网站或应用程序的需求,并提供稳定和高效的服务。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/74691.html<